The Surrey FA Youth Forum has been shortlisted in the Youth Engagement Category

Relaunched in October 2022, after a long break due to COVID-19, the Surrey FA Youth Forum returned for the 2022/23 season. 

The Youth Forum comprises of individuals aged 16-24, with a diverse membership including 38% of members from historically under-represented backgrounds and 38% female. This diverse variety helps provide insight into different communities and helps provide meaningful and inclusive opportunities for young people in local grassroots football. 

Every member has a specific role within the group from Marketing Champion to Women & Girl’s Champion. Each role has a clear link to Surrey FA at both a staff and board level, with chair Emma Clarke sitting on the main board. This ensures that the voice of young people throughout the county is heard and is informing the organisations' goals. 

In the 2022/23 season, the Youth Forum team has embedded across many of the County’s programmes and has worked hard to increase its visibility across local football.  The main activities the group have supported or delivered included; career fairs, delivering talks to St Mary’s University, County Cup Finals, activations with new Surrey FA partners Thorpe Park Resorts, hosting the Surrey FA International Women’s Day networking panel and launching a kit donation campaign in association with Kit4Causes. 

The Youth Forum will continue to build on last season’s success and has already started to outline some potential goals and objectives for the 2023/24 season. The team are keen to have a more significant presence across grassroots clubs in the county, aiming to increase the number of youth committees in clubs. The Youth Forum will also continue their ‘Surrey Roadshow’ by taking their meetings to different clubs and role modelling what it could look like for them with the help of young people.
